"I can't find good people. And if I find them, I can't keep them." This is the lament of many leaders looking for values-aligned people to help grow their organizations or when they are planning to exit their organization. And yet many organizations find good people, grow them and build an amazing organization.

Two specialists from the US with Vanderbloemen Search Group (VSG), Eric Albert and Bryson Isom, will be leading the workshop.

VSG is the leader in North America with respect to finding values-aligned people to grow organization. VSG has a deep understanding of the unique challenges and opportunities facing organizations with a greater purpose and finding top talent to lead you into the future is their mission.

This workshop is for HR managers/directors and senior leaders in an organization.

This workshop will focus on “best practices” that help get results in four categories:

  • Values-based business executives - Connect values with vision, securing executives who can balance a business’s needs to make a profit with their mission and vision for the future.
  • Nonprofit executives - Find CxO's and divisional leaders who will deliver on strategic goals—while keeping the mission and values at the forefront.
  • Church executives - Go farther, faster with a church leader who possesses a deep understanding of theology and ministry, while providing direction and management of a church and its people.
  • Faith-based school executives - Ensure the long-term success of your school and its students. Executive leadership is pivotal in providing a high-quality education that is aligned with your mission and values.
